What are the Factors of 65304

Factors of 65304 =1, 2, 3, 4, 6, 8, 9, 12, 18, 24, 36, 72, 907, 1814, 2721, 3628, 5442, 7256, 8163, 10884, 16326, 21768, 32652, 65304

Factors are whole numbers or integers that are multiplied together to produce a given number. The integers or whole numbers multiplied are factors of the given number. If x multiplied by y = z then x and y are factors of z.

if for instance you want to find the factors of 20. You will have to find combination of numbers that when it is multiplied together will give 20. Example here is 5 and 4 because when you multiplied them, it will give you 20. so they are factors of the given number 20. Also 1 and 20, 2 and 10 are factors of 20 because 1 x 20 = 20 and 2 x 10 = 20. The factors of the given interger number 20 are 1, 2, 4, 5, 10, 20
